Coffeescript эквивалентно готовому документу - PullRequest
0 голосов
/ 20 мая 2018

Я пытаюсь использовать Coffeescript, но у меня проблема с моим веб-приложением.Его методы не вызываются, пока я не перезагружаю страницу.

Я думаю, что отсутствует часть $(document).ready(function () {, но я не смог найти, как это сделать в Интернете.

file_name.js (отлично работает)

$(document).ready(function () {
  $(document).on('click', '.add_fields', function(event) {
    event.preventDefault();
    /* Act on the event */
    time = new Date().getTime()
    regexp = new RegExp($(this).data('id'), 'g')
    $(this).before($(this).data('fields').replace(regexp, time))
  });
});

file_name.coffee (не работает)

jQuery ->
  $('form').on 'click', '.add_fields', (event) ->
    time = new Date().getTime()
    regexp = new RegExp($(this).data('id'), 'g')
    $(this).before($(this).data('fields').replace(regexp, time))
    event.preventDefault()

Как я могу исправитьэто?

1 Ответ

0 голосов
/ 20 мая 2018
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...